Переключение пути SVG

Опубликовано: 2023-01-13

Если вы хотите знать, как переключать путь SVG, то вы попали в нужное место. Это руководство покажет вам, как сделать это с легкостью. SVG, или Scalable Vector Graphics, представляет собой формат векторного изображения на основе XML для двумерной графики с поддержкой интерактивности и анимации. Спецификация SVG — это открытый стандарт, разработанный Консорциумом World Wide Web (W3C) с 1999 года. Изображения SVG и их поведение определяются в текстовых файлах XML. Это означает, что их можно искать, индексировать, создавать сценарии и сжимать. Как файлы XML, изображения SVG можно создавать и редактировать с помощью любого текстового редактора, но чаще всего они создаются с помощью программного обеспечения для рисования.

CodePen позволяет вам написать все, что находится внутри основного шаблона HTML5, и включить его в редактор HTML. Это то место, куда можно обратиться, если вы хотите получить доступ к элементам более высокого уровня, таким как тег >html>. CSS легко доступен из любой таблицы стилей в Интернете. Вы можете написать сценарий из любого места в Интернете и применить его к своей ручке. Поместите URL-адрес здесь, и мы добавим его, как только он будет в указанном вами порядке, перед JavaScript в Pen. Чтобы подать заявку, нам нужно обработать расширение файла сценария, на который вы ссылаетесь, которое обычно включается в URL-адрес сценария.

Что такое путь Svg?

Что такое путь Svg?
Изображение: https://designlooter.com

В SVG элемент path определяет путь. Все формы имеют эквивалентный путь в качестве формы, что определяет их структуру как путь. Путь элемента, который является просто его путем, аналогичен пути элемента «путь».

Форма объекта определяется перемещением его контура по траектории, состоящей из moveto, lineto, curveto (как кубической, так и квадратичной формы Безье), дуг и closepaths. Составные пути (например, с несколькими вложенными путями) позволяют отображать объекты с отверстиями в виде пончиков. В этой главе мы рассмотрим синтаксис, поведение и интерфейсы DOM для путей SVG . Данные пути представляют собой серию команд, за которыми следует один символ. Важно помнить, что данные пути имеют простой синтаксис, который обеспечивает небольшой размер файла и более быструю загрузку. Данные пути могут содержать символы новой строки, поэтому несколько строк можно разбить для улучшения читаемости. При анализе символов XML символы новой строки в разметке будут нормализованы до символов пробела.

Строка пути указывает путь, по которому сохраняется фигура. Ошибки данных пути следует обрабатывать в соответствии с разделом «Обработка ошибок данных пути». Команда moveto (если есть) должна использоваться для создания сегмента данных пути (если есть). Автоматические прямые линии рисуются от текущей точки до начальной точки текущего подконтура. Этот сегмент пути может быть небольшим. Близкие пути работают следующим образом: конец последнего сегмента подпути соединяется с началом первого сегмента с текущим значением «stroke-linejoin». Закрытый подконтур ведет себя иначе, чем открытый подконтур, первый и последний сегменты которого не соединены вместе.

Операции с закрытым путем, такие как компенсация сегмента, в настоящее время не поддерживаются в Python. Различные команды lineto рисуют прямые линии от текущей точки к новой точке. Когда используется относительная команда l, строка заканчивается на (cPX X, Cpy Y). Когда относительная команда h задается с положительным значением x, горизонтальная линия будет проведена в направлении положительной оси x. Первые пять примеров показывают один кубический сегмент пути. Команду эллиптических дуг можно использовать следующим образом: Когда используется относительная команда a, дуга определяется как CPY, CPX и Y. Флаг большой дуги и флаг развертки указывают, какая из четырех дуг нарисован. Процесс обработки EBNF должен потреблять как можно больше данной продукции в момент, когда персонаж больше не соответствует производственным требованиям.

Когда значение свойства d равно нулю, рендеринг отключен. При расчете формы крышки и отрисовке маркеров направление по умолчанию на границах сегмента переопределяется. Дуга, соединенная с конечными точками либо RY, либо rx, считается прямой линией (линия к линии). Математическая формула для масштабирования этой операции находится в приложении. Сегменты пути без длины могут повлиять на визуализацию в следующих случаях. Атрибут 'pathLength' можно использовать для вычисления общей длины пути для автора, что упрощает вычисление расстояния по пути для пользовательского агента. Чтобы считаться операцией перемещения, длина элемента path не должна превышать нулевую длину. Длина пути рассчитывается с использованием всего нескольких команд, наиболее важными из которых являются lineto, curveto и arcto.

Атрибут D: для чего он используется?

Для чего используется атрибут d?
Путь определяется с помощью атрибута d.

Как отображать SVGS?

Как отображать SVGS?
Изображение: https://pinimg.com

Чтобы отобразить изображение SVG, вам нужно использовать тег. У тега есть несколько обязательных атрибутов: src, ширина и высота. Атрибут src используется для указания местоположения изображения, а атрибуты ширины и высоты — для указания размера изображения.

Файл масштабируемой векторной графики (SVG) представляет собой файл масштабируемой векторной графики (SVG). Файл определяется как компьютерное приложение, которое использует стандартный формат файла SVG для отображения изображения. Их можно масштабировать различными способами без потери качества или резкости. Они могут иметь место в любое время, потому что они не зависят от разрешения и могут иметь место в любом размере. Вам понадобится приложение, поддерживающее формат SVG, чтобы создать или отредактировать файл SVG. Adobe Illustrator, Inkscape и GIMP — бесплатные программы, позволяющие сохранять изображения в формате .VNG. В качестве альтернативы можно использовать бесплатный онлайн-конвертер, такой как SVGtoPNG.com, для преобразования SVL в растровый формат.

Когда вы коснетесь элемента, он отобразит панель стилей; когда вы касаетесь элемента, он также отображает панель стилей. Когда вы нажмете кнопку «Стиль», он будет применен как к элементу, так и к любому выбранному вами дочернему элементу. Выберите стиль из списка, затем нажмите, чтобы удалить его. Выберите SVG, чтобы сохранить изменения, затем нажмите «Сохранить». Ваши веб-приложения и мобильные приложения могут быть созданы с использованием векторных изображений, а не изображений JPG и PNG. Их можно редактировать в Office для Android и сохранять в виде нового файла с тем же именем, если они созданы с нуля.

Почему вы должны использовать графику Svg

С помощью векторного графического формата, такого как SVG, вы можете создавать высококачественные изображения, которые можно использовать в различных приложениях. Теперь, когда все основные браузеры поддерживают файлы SVG , вы можете просмотреть их с помощью панели предварительного просмотра Проводника. Есть несколько программ, которые могут открывать файлы SVG, включая Google Chrome, Firefox, IE, Opera и CorelDRAW.

Как скрыть файл Svg?

Как скрыть файл Svg?
Изображение: https://imgur.com

Есть несколько способов скрыть файл SVG. Один из способов — сохранить файл в формате .jpg или .png. Другой способ — использовать файл CSS, чтобы скрыть файл.

Плюсы и минусы использования Svg

Это отличный формат для логотипов, значков и другой плоской графики, в которой используются простые цвета и формы. Точно так же он хорошо подходит для изображений с большим количеством мелких деталей и текстур, а также для фотографий. Из-за векторной природы SVG он неэффективен для изображений с большим количеством мелких деталей и текстур. Использование SVG — лучший вариант для логотипов, значков и другой плоской графики, в которой используются более простые цвета и формы. Хотя большинство современных браузеров поддерживают SVG, старые браузеры могут с ним плохо работать.


Команды пути SVG

Путь SVG — это уникальный тип графики, который можно использовать на веб-сайтах. Он создается с помощью набора команд, которые сообщают компьютеру, как рисовать графику. Команды очень просты, и их можно комбинировать для создания сложной графики. Наиболее распространенными командами являются M, что означает движение, и L, что означает линию. Эти две команды могут быть использованы для создания любой мыслимой формы.

Следующие команды можно использовать для изменения атрибута d элементов. Если путь содержит ошибку, браузер генерирует все сегменты до тех пор, пока ошибка не будет найдена. Геометрия пути в атрибуте пути (и в SVG 2) также описывается в том же синтаксисе. Кубическая кривая Безье прорисовывается до заданной конечной точки с помощью автоматического расчета контрольной точки, гарантируя, что предыдущий сегмент кубической кривой не будет потерян. С помощью x-фактора можно рассчитать контрольную точку. Смещение по оси Y от контрольной точки предыдущего сегмента до его конечной точки. Ошибки вызваны списком координат, которые невозможно сгруппировать в наборы из четырех.

Невозможно установить квадратичную кривую равной нулю с помощью линейной алгебры. Координаты пользователей всегда выводятся из предыдущего сегмента контрольной точки для команд, а точки с s-командами всегда относятся к точкам с s-командами. Ошибка в Arc-to делает невозможным разделение набора координат на четыре секции. Когда сегмент эллиптической дуги рисуется до конечной точки с использованием указанных параметров, создается сегмент эллиптической дуги. Находит два конца линии в линии соединения, рисуя прямую линию (при необходимости) от текущей позиции до точки, определенной самой последней командой перемещения. Ошибки команды закрытия пути включают любые числа, которые появляются в конце команды закрытия пути. Определение относительных команд будет изменено, если используется команда пеленга (B или b).

Пути в SVG

В атрибуте d есть число, представляющее длину пути в пикселях. Можно создать путь длиной от 1 пикселя или длиной, равной ширине контейнера документа, а также его высоте. Есть несколько моментов, о которых следует помнить при использовании команды Close Path. Команда Close Path влияет только на узел в данный момент. Команду Close Path необходимо использовать на родительском узле, если вы хотите закрыть путь вокруг всех его дочерних узлов. Команда Close Path не будет генерировать объект в конце пути; он просто указывает текущую позицию. Если вы хотите сохранить путь для последующего использования, вы должны сначала создать объект пути с помощью команды «Путь». Невозможно использовать команду «Закрыть путь», чтобы закрыть путь. Команда Path создаст замкнутый путь, который будет начинаться и заканчиваться в одних и тех же местах.

Значки путей SVG

Значки пути SVG — это значки, которые можно настроить любого размера или цвета без потери качества. Они идеально подходят для адаптивного дизайна, потому что их можно легко масштабировать под любой размер экрана.

Как получить код Svg для значка?

Когда вы нажмете на иллюстрацию, вам будет предложено ввести HTML-код вашего значка SVG. Вам просто нужно будет скопировать и вставить код, чтобы завершить процесс. Вы можете создавать свои собственные SVG с помощью таких программ, как Illustrator.

Иконки Svg: отличный выбор для личных и коммерческих проектов

Так просто использовать значки SVG для множества потрясающих проектов. Их можно использовать в различных форматах, включая веб-приложения и мобильные приложения, веб-сайты и печатные публикации. Вы можете использовать эти значки в различных контекстах, таких как дизайн продукта и иллюстрация, и они идеально подходят для использования значков высокого качества. Вы можете бесплатно загружать и использовать значки SVG, что делает их отличным выбором как для личных, так и для коммерческих проектов.

Что лучше Svg или значки шрифтов?

В то время как шрифты значков могут быть изменены разработчиком, шрифты SVG более адаптируемы. Первый шаг — добавить больше цветов с помощью шаблонов sva. Значок SVG — это тип шрифта, который позволяет создавать градиентные изображения. Кроме того, отдельные штрихи можно анимировать с помощью значков SVG.

Множество преимуществ продажи файлов Svg в Интернете

При использовании файлов SVG вы можете включать в свой пользовательский интерфейс логотипы, значки, иллюстрации и другие элементы. Из-за этого файлы SVG становятся все более популярными среди дизайнеров и компаний, стремящихся создавать цифровые продукты и продавать их в Интернете.
Одним из основных преимуществ продажи файлов SVG в Интернете является то, что их можно настроить в соответствии с конкретными потребностями каждого клиента. Вы сможете создавать продукты, специально предназначенные для вашего целевого рынка, и у вас будет больше шансов их продать.
При продаже файлов SVG в Интернете одной из самых серьезных проблем будет конкуренция. Ниже приведены примеры альтернативных языков программирования, которые можно использовать для создания файлов: JavaScript, SVG, Modernizr, Modernizr и Lodash. Эти языки используют дизайнеры и компании, которые хотят создавать цифровые продукты и продавать их в Интернете.
Поскольку файлы SVG настолько универсальны, они также популярны среди клиентов, которые хотят создавать свои собственные проекты. Вы по-прежнему можете зарабатывать деньги, продавая файлы SVG, даже если ваши конкуренты продают более традиционные продукты.
Интернет — хорошее место для начала бизнеса по продаже файлов SVG, если вы хотите зарабатывать на жизнь их продажей. Существуют книги и онлайн-статьи, содержащие информацию об открытии бизнеса и продажах в Интернете, а также вы можете найти конкретные ресурсы, которые помогут вам продавать файлы SVG в Интернете.